Last evening they found the drainage tube placed in the top of his head was leaking. The team of Neuro Surgeons made the decision to do an additional surgery and insert a shunt.


This morning that surgical procedure was set at 9 AM. It got moved up a hour while I was on the way to Birmingham.


Emily's husband Josh, her mother in law Kay Fails and sister in law Stephanie McCorkle has been staying up there. Brantley's dad had been there also as was myself.


Last evening when I asked Emily did she want me to be there she said yes. Understand, due to COVID-19 they will not let me in the hospital or in Brantley's room. The last time I have seen Brantley other than FACETIME was when he was placed in the helicopter in Dothan on May 10.


So even going up there I could not go in the hospital. So I took tons of paperwork in boxes to sit and work on while waiting on his surgery. Tons of paperwork on my role in Emergency Management and Emergency Medical Services.


Brantley did great. The doctors were pleased with the outcome. The first drain was on top of his head and shunt is in the back of his head. He will have a shunt the rest of his life. His participation in heavy contact sports is over. He can play basketball, baseball, some of those sports in time.


If Brantley continues to improve as he has been, hopefully ( prayerfully ) he will be released from Children's Hospital over the weekend. And that boy is ready to come home.
